Nancy Lorenz (BFA 85) will display her work at the Berkshire Botanical Garden in Stockbridge, MA. Her exhibition, Shimmering Flowers, is comprised of bronze-cast landscapes and vessels inspired by techniques from traditional Asian craft. The opening reception will be on May 31st from 5 – 7 pm and her exhibit will be on display from June 1st through September 30th.

Nancy Lorenz incorporates techniques from traditional Asian crafts, drawing on her years spent living in Japan and a thirty-five-year career as a noted contemporary abstract painter. For Shimmering Flowers, Ms. Lorenz has created gilt and mother-of-pearl paintings that complement the Garden’s collection of flora and will also present table-top landscape vessels in cast bronze, creating a dialogue with the galleries and their surrounding gardens. Throughout the summer, these vessels will display arrangements created by a rotating group of talented floral designers whose interpretations of the art are reflected in unique displays of flowers and other natural materials.
